Job Title Assistant Manager

Location Greeneville, TN

Salary $10.00 - $13.50 hourly

Department Operations

FLSA Status Non-Exempt

Reports To Store Manager

Summary The Assistant Manager is responsible for assisting and consulting the Store Manager regarding overall operations and administrative duties, including determining the methods and approaches necessary to accomplish the store’s goals. The Assistant Manager is knowledgeable in each product area or department in our store, upholds policies, procedures and standards listed in the visual manual, provides outstanding customer service, promotes the merchandise, and assumes supervisory control in the Store Manager’s absence.

Essential Duties And Responsibilities

Assist the Store Manager in controlling the assets of Hibbett I City Gear.

Consult with the Store Manager to establish action plans to accomplish departmental and overall store responsibilities such as selling, restocking, merchandising, ordering, and scheduling.

Assume responsibility of the entire store in the absence of the Store Manager.

Assist the Store Manager in overall personnel recruiting, training, and evaluation.

Provide knowledge and guidance to employees and customers in all departments when necessary.

Be aware of inventory, sales statistics, and expenses to ensure profitability in all departments.

Direct staff to ensure each department’s responsibilities and standards are completed.

Keep the Store Manager informed about inventory movement and customer trends.

Assure quality customer service is maintained.

Perform general administrative duties as needed and be trained in the Store Manager’s responsibilities.

Provide extraordinary customer service highlighted in the customer service manual, including helping customers as they enter the store and helping multiple customers during peak periods.

Promote and sell services and merchandise provided by Hibbett I City Gear.

Practice and uphold all Hibbett I City Gear policies, procedures, and standards as listed in the operations policy manual, personnel policy manual, visual manual, customer service manual, and memos with the company’s direction.

Protect the company’s assets and financial information by ensuring the accuracy and effectiveness of internal control procedures and informing management or appropriate officials of potential fraud risk.

Supervisory Responsibilities Supervises employees in the absence of the Store Manager and carries out supervisory responsibilities in accordance with the organization’s policies and applicable laws. Responsibilities include interviewing, training employees, planning, assigning, and directing work, and resolving problems.

Qualifications

Experience working in a retail environment, preferably in footwear and athletic apparel.

1-3 years of customer service experience.

Excellent interpersonal and communication skills.

Ability to work in a fast‑paced environment.

Ability to assist in managing a team and keep up with overall goals and profits.

Self‑starter with initiative to take on important tasks without being asked.

Strong attention to detail with the ability to handle multiple tasks simultaneously and with precision.

Team‑player, passionate about outstanding customer service and selling merchandise.
